Alder Creek Elementary School opened on August 8, 2024. Nestled against the foothills of El Dorado, the homes of the Folsom Ranch community surrounding the campus. The future site of a park (coming 2027) is adjacent to the campus and will serve as a wonderful area for families to meet and play. Students in grades transitional kindergarten (TK) through fifth attend Alder Creek. There are approximately 575 students at Alder Creek Elementary, a population with 16% identified English Learner (EL) students, 0% foster youth, 16% of students qualifying for ""unduplicated"" status. The surrounding neighborhood is populated with families who are highly involved and eager to participate in the education of their children. The school reflects a culture of learning and a strong home-school connection. Alder Creek operates on a traditional calendar that begins in August, provides three trimesters of instruction for our students, and ends in May. The staff is made up of educators who hold California Teaching Credentials and paraprofessionals who support our students and staff.

The campus is made up of one primary two-story building, which includes five wings, a library, a multipurpose room, and an administration office. The building was built with collaboration in mind. Classrooms have glass accordion doors that open up to common areas that provide for opportunities for students and staff to engage with each other. A detached Student Care building for before and after school care also sits on our property to the south. Many students attend the before and after school Student Care Center located on campus.

The school has Chromebooks in every classroom to enhance access to technology as a tool for learning. Each classroom is equipped with a document camera and Promethean Board to enhance learning and allow teachers to interact and engage with their students through technology.

Alder Creek Elementary School students have opportunities to be involved in Student Leadership, physical education, Gifted & Talented Education (GATE), music, and Special Education Services. Students can participate in after school enrichment activities such as engineering, art, coding, dance, chess, athletics, and other extra-curricular clubs.
